    Vinyl sales drop 33⅓ as greed threatens to ruin the revival



    For years now we’ve been living in a vinyl revival, with sales of vinyl LPs and the best turntables in rude health. But new data from Billboard suggests that this particular listening party could be coming to an end. Between 2023 and 2024, US vinyl sales dropped 33.3%. That’s much more of a drop than CD sales (down 19.5%) or digital albums (down 8.3%). And it’s not been replaced by streaming, which is only up 7.2%.

    The problem’s pretty simple. Vinyl almost always costs too much now.
